    STEERING LSTEERING LSTEERING LSTEERING LSTEERING L OCK CUM IGNITION SWITOCK CUM IGNITION SWITOCK CUM IGNITION SWITOCK CUM IGNITION SWITOCK CUM IGNITION SWIT CCCCCONONONONONBy turning the key to this position all remaining electricalsystems become operative and lamps of batt ery chargingindicator, low oil pressure will come ON.In ON position, the glow plug controller switches ON theglow plugs and glow indicator lights up. After a fewseconds, depending on the ambient temperature, theindicator light only goes off indicating that the engine canbe started. Glow plugs remain ON for few seconds andswitches OFF automatically.As a safety feature glow plugs are automatically switchedOFF after a lapse of certain time if the engine is not startedto conserve battery.

    In this case to start the engine repeat the operation byfirst going to ACC or LOCK position.

    STSTSTSTSTARARARARARTTTTTTurn the key further clockwise to start position (springloaded) to operate starter motor. As soon as the enginestarts release the ignition key, so that key can come backto ON position and starter motor disengages and glowplug is switched OFF. Vehicle is driven in this position. By

    turning the ignit ion key from ON position to ACC or LOCKposition engine can be stopped.

    TTTTTurburburburburb ooooo charcharcharcharchar gergergergergerTurbocharger is an efficient supercharging device used in ourengine. It makes use of thermal energy of engine exhaust gases torun a turbine which in turn drives a compressor to force air underpressure into the inlet manifold.

    LLLLLubrubrubrubrubr icicicicicaaaaa tion oftion oftion oftion oftion of TTTTTurburburburburb ooooo charcharcharcharchar gergergergergerThe rotor assembly of the turbocharger is supported by two floatinglead bronze sleeve bearings in t he bearing housing. These bearingsare lubricated with the linest filtered and cooled oil from thelubrication system of the engine. There is a heat shield arrangementprovided between the gas chamber of t he turbine and the bearinghousing to avoid heating of t he bearings.

    MMMMMainainainainain ttttt enancenancenancenancenanc e ofe ofe ofe ofe of TTTTTurburburburburb ooooo charcharcharcharchar ger :ger :ger :ger :ger :1. Tighten the following fasteners at PDI and thereafter at every

    10,000 km.- Turbocharger mounting- Turbocharger hose connections and its mountings

    2. Check intercooler fins for any dust accumulations and cleanby compressed air at every 20,000 km. (if fitted)

    3. It is advisable to run the engine at idle speed for about oneminute, after starting and before stopping the engine. Thisensures adequate lubricating oil supply to the turbocharger.

    POPOPOPOPO WER STEERINGWER STEERINGWER STEERINGWER STEERINGWER STEERING (When provided)Power steering is fitted for lighter steering effort and easymanoeuvrability. The system consists of steering gear box,hydraulic pump and hydraulic reservoir suitably mounted andconnected by piping. Pump drive is through belt from engine.Power assistance is available during normal functioning of the

    power steering system.In case of any failure in hydraulic system, the steering In case of any failure in hydraulic system, the steering In case of any failure in hydraulic system, the steering In case of any failure in hydraulic system, the steering In case of any failure in hydraulic system, the steering can be operated mechanically with increased steering can be operated mechanically with increased steering can be operated mechanically with increased steering can be operated mechanically with increased steering can be operated mechanically with increased steering effort for bringing the vehicle to a repair station.effort for bringing the vehicle to a repair station.effort for bringing the vehicle to a repair station.effort for bringing the vehicle to a repair station.effort for bringing the vehicle to a repair station.Procedure for oil filling and bleeding the power steeringProcedure for oil filling and bleeding the power steeringProcedure for oil filling and bleeding the power steeringProcedure for oil filling and bleeding the power steeringProcedure for oil filling and bleeding the power steeringsystem.system.system.system.system. ( Ensure that the reservoir is totally cleaned beforestarting the work. )1. Fill t he reservoir nearly full. Crank the engine for 10 seconds

    without, if possible, allowing it t o start. If the engine does

    start, shut off immediately. Check and refill the reservoir.Repeat atleast three times, each time checking and refillingthe reservoir.

    2. Check for any leakage in the system and if noticed takecorrective action.

    3. Start the engine and steer the vehicle from full left to fullright turn 3-4 times. Add fluid if necessary to maintain thelevel up to the filter top.

    4. With the engine at steady speed check for bubble /foamingin the fluid. If present it indicates that air is getting suckedinto the system.

    Check the suction line / fit tings and correct if necessary.5. Once the system is bled properly and free from foaming,

    there should not be appreciable change in fluid level inthe reservoir, when the engine is started / stop repeatedly.Top up or remove excess fluid so that the final level is at Hmark on dipstick.

    6. Now the system is ready for driving.

    Power steering pump belt tension CheckPower steering pump belt tension CheckPower steering pump belt tension CheckPower steering pump belt tension CheckPower steering pump belt tension Check

    Check the condit ions of belts on t he engine. Examine theedge of the belt for cracks or fraying.

    Check the tension of the belt by pushing on it with your

    thumb Alternator/Power Steering belt as shown in Figure.The belts should have deflection of 8 to 10 mm. (X)

    If the belt tension is not proper, get it attended at thenearest Authorised service outlet.
